If the point P(-4/5,y) lies on the unit circle and P is in the third quadrant, what does y equal? If necessary, use the slash mark ( / ) for a fraction bar.

We use the fact that x2+y2=1  This is the equation of the unit circle.
We know that x=-4/5, so plug this in and solve for y
x2+y2=1 (−4/5)^2+y2=1 16/25+y2=1 y2=1−16/25 y2=9/25 y=−square root of 9/ 25
y = -3/5
